**Action item:** Refactor the legacy ORM layer in Marlowe Systems' billing service. As the incoming contractor, please read the session-lifecycle notes first; the old mapper leaks connections when retries exceed the pool ceiling, which caused last month's outage. Migrate one aggregate at a time, keeping the shadow-write comparison enabled throughout. The pool, retry, and batch settings you must preserve are given below.

constants for tafog-kahag:
RATE_LIMITS = {
    "sorir": 697,
    "oliox": 683,
    "holax": 176,
    "casox": 60,
    "pelius": 382,
}

MEMO — Kettling Depot Receiving

Uniform sets for the new Kettling depot arrive Wednesday via Ashgrove courier: 40 boxes, sorted by size, manifest attached to box one. Check the count at the dock before signing; shortages go straight to stores, not the courier. The hand-over instruction the courier will follow is set out below.

drop instructions, tafof-baguf: the holmir gilox courier leaves the sormir ulaok holdor ledger at gate 5596 under passcode 257343

Finance Review Summary — Insurance Renewal

Sales leads: the annual renewal with Brindlecote Assurance closed at a 7% premium increase, below the 12% initially quoted. Coverage terms unchanged except a higher deductible on fleet claims. Factor the new deductible into deal margins on delivery-heavy accounts. Cargo rider stays as-is. Renewal is effective from the start of next quarter; certificates go out to branches next week. One point is for this distribution only and appears below:

board note of kageg-bahof: The renewal with Holwynax Holdings closes at $2 million a year, 5 percent below the last contract. Project Ulaath slips by two quarters because of the supplier delay.

Quillgate loads data validators from the plugin registry at boot. Set `QG_PLUGIN_DIR=/opt/quillgate/plugins` and `QG_VALIDATOR_TIMEOUT_MS=2000`. If a plugin fails its checksum, Quillgate refuses to start — check the manifest in the plugin bundle before blaming the loader. Third-party validators are fetched from the Marrowfield registry mirror, so confirm outbound access from the app hosts. The registry rejects anonymous pulls, so before restarting the service, append the following line to `/etc/quillgate/env`:

sealed setting: ARCHIVE_KEY3=8d0